Output 30135320ed881f72fc17b9cbbe4b37395d7d4394541e851a9e4d8a904180a282:11

value
2291236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867d89e6f1cf0269b9ae7b35720dff7683c69c63 OP_EQUAL
address
3Dx8rq4WbWBVfDpWAkkqJfqGr8KrsDA8Gh
transaction
30135320ed881f72fc17b9cbbe4b37395d7d4394541e851a9e4d8a904180a282
spent
true